    Whether you're looking for a pushchair to tackle woodland walks or strolls on the main streets, a pushchair that is all-terrain with excellent manoeuvrability will be the perfect fit. These models are usually equipped with large wheels and suspension that gives an easy ride on rough terrain.

    Many are suitable for babies and come with seats that can be set in a flat position or a carrycot for newborns. They also usually have foam-filled never-flat tyres to reduce maintenance.

    Suspension

    A genuine all-terrain pushchair will have a sturdy suspension that is specifically designed to be ultra smooth and comfortable on rough terrain. This will make your child feel more relaxed and comfortable. The wheels will also be large and typically be puncture-proof to protect against damage caused by sharp rocks or sticks.

    Some all-terrain strollers also allow you to switch between additional tyres for different conditions. Certain all-terrain strollers come with an swivel wheel that can be locked to offer stability or unlocked to allow for greater maneuverability.

    A few all-terrain strollers include a brake handbrake lockable that is easy to reach with your free hand. This is more convenient than an ordinary pedal on the handlebars. This is an excellent feature for those who are a fan of steep hills.

    There are many strollers with excellent off-road capabilities, but not the ultimate. They also have big wheels and great suspension. These are usually less expensive than full-on all terrain buggy models and can be suitable for short walks in the countryside or trips to the park.

    A lot of strollers are suitable for newborns and come with a carrycot or car seat that is ready for infants. However, be aware that when it comes to pushing over bumps and dips, the seats aren't completely flat. According to EU regulations they only have to meet minimum requirements for reclined position of around 150deg. Graco has gotten around this issue with its new 'comfitech seat suspension' which allows the seat recline to a more comfortable angle for more comfort. This is available on the Lila XP all-terrain pushchair which can be used with an appropriate Graco infant car seat to create a 3- in one travel system.

    Wheels

    If you reside in a rural area or frequently take your child on walks over rough ground, an all-terrain pushchair is essential. These pushchairs have larger wheels on the back of traditional pushchairs, which enables them to handle bumpy terrain better and provide an easier ride for your child. Many also come with a sturdy suspension and puncture-proof types which make them suitable for use on woodland, grass or paths through the forest or gravel tracks, as well as market town cobbles.

    Some all-terrain pushchairs also feature an adjustable front wheel that offers extra stability when walking over rough terrain and on high kerbs. Some have swivel wheels on the front which allows you to move the buggy more easily in case you want to change direction or turn corners.

    Most all-terrain pushchairs have air-filled tyres, which provide excellent shock absorption and are great for rough terrain, however they're more susceptible to punctures than the solid EVA tyres used on lightweight 3 wheel buggy city strollers which is why you should invest in an repair kit along with a spare inner tube and pump to go with your pushchair. Some all-terrain models have foam tyres, which are less susceptible to punctures but aren't as good at absorption of shock and can be more difficult to push than tyres with air filled.

    The new Bugaboo Fox 5 pushchair is a great example of a stroller that includes both foam and air filled tyres. It also comes with an excellent suspension and large rear wheels that are puncture resistant and ideal for off-road use or running (once your child reaches an appropriate age). The model is also suitable for children from birth and can be used in conjunction with a carrycot or a lay-flat seat.

    Another alternative is the iCandy Peach All-Terrain, which features large tyres as well as only a single steering wheel in the front. It's not as flexible as the other strollers that are all-terrain, but it can manage hilly terrain and has a spacious one-handed fold that is great for long walks in the countryside, or long journeys. It's also suitable from birth and has a huge sun canopy that extends and a host of great features for parents, including an easy-to-use brake pedal, adjustable handlebar and generously spacious basket.
